Thu Jan 4 22:42:52 2024 UTC (139d)
py-progressbar2: updated to 4.3.2

v4.3.2
disabling run-command until it is properly finished

v4.3.1
fixed typeerror on Windows
excluded docs from install
added readthedocs configuration file


(adam)
diff -r1.10 -r1.11 pkgsrc/devel/py-progressbar2/Makefile
diff -r1.3 -r1.4 pkgsrc/devel/py-progressbar2/PLIST
diff -r1.8 -r1.9 pkgsrc/devel/py-progressbar2/distinfo

cvs diff -r1.10 -r1.11 pkgsrc/devel/py-progressbar2/Makefile (expand / switch to unified diff)

--- pkgsrc/devel/py-progressbar2/Makefile 2023/12/20 18:52:12 1.10
+++ pkgsrc/devel/py-progressbar2/Makefile 2024/01/04 22:42:52 1.11
@@ -1,38 +1,34 @@ @@ -1,38 +1,34 @@
1# $NetBSD: Makefile,v 1.10 2023/12/20 18:52:12 nros Exp $ 1# $NetBSD: Makefile,v 1.11 2024/01/04 22:42:52 adam Exp $
2 2
3DISTNAME= progressbar2-4.3.0 3DISTNAME= progressbar2-4.3.2
4PKGNAME= ${PYPKGPREFIX}-${DISTNAME} 4PKGNAME= ${PYPKGPREFIX}-${DISTNAME}
5CATEGORIES= devel python 5CATEGORIES= devel python
6MASTER_SITES= ${MASTER_SITE_PYPI:=p/progressbar2/} 6MASTER_SITES= ${MASTER_SITE_PYPI:=p/progressbar2/}
7 7
8MAINTAINER= pkgsrc-users@NetBSD.org 8MAINTAINER= pkgsrc-users@NetBSD.org
9HOMEPAGE= https://github.com/WoLpH/python-progressbar 9HOMEPAGE= https://github.com/WoLpH/python-progressbar
10COMMENT= Text progress bar library for Python 10COMMENT= Text progress bar library for Python
11LICENSE= modified-bsd 11LICENSE= modified-bsd
12 12
13TOOL_DEPENDS+= ${PYPKGPREFIX}-setuptools-[0-9]*:../../devel/py-setuptools 13TOOL_DEPENDS+= ${PYPKGPREFIX}-setuptools-[0-9]*:../../devel/py-setuptools
14TOOL_DEPENDS+= ${PYPKGPREFIX}-wheel-[0-9]*:../../devel/py-wheel 14TOOL_DEPENDS+= ${PYPKGPREFIX}-wheel-[0-9]*:../../devel/py-wheel
15DEPENDS+= ${PYPKGPREFIX}-utils>=3.8.1:../../devel/py-utils 15DEPENDS+= ${PYPKGPREFIX}-utils>=3.8.1:../../devel/py-utils
16TEST_DEPENDS+= ${PYPKGPREFIX}-dill>=0.3.6:../../textproc/py-dill 16TEST_DEPENDS+= ${PYPKGPREFIX}-dill>=0.3.6:../../textproc/py-dill
17TEST_DEPENDS+= ${PYPKGPREFIX}-flake8>=3.7.7:../../devel/py-flake8 17TEST_DEPENDS+= ${PYPKGPREFIX}-flake8>=3.7.7:../../devel/py-flake8
18TEST_DEPENDS+= ${PYPKGPREFIX}-freezegun>=0.3.11:../../devel/py-freezegun 18TEST_DEPENDS+= ${PYPKGPREFIX}-freezegun>=0.3.11:../../devel/py-freezegun
19TEST_DEPENDS+= ${PYPKGPREFIX}-sphinx>=1.8.5:../../textproc/py-sphinx 19TEST_DEPENDS+= ${PYPKGPREFIX}-sphinx>=1.8.5:../../textproc/py-sphinx
20TEST_DEPENDS+= ${PYPKGPREFIX}-test-cov>=2.6.1:../../devel/py-test-cov 20TEST_DEPENDS+= ${PYPKGPREFIX}-test-cov>=2.6.1:../../devel/py-test-cov
21TEST_DEPENDS+= ${PYPKGPREFIX}-test-mypy-[0-9]*:../../devel/py-test-mypy 21TEST_DEPENDS+= ${PYPKGPREFIX}-test-mypy-[0-9]*:../../devel/py-test-mypy
22 22
23USE_LANGUAGES= # none 23USE_LANGUAGES= # none
24 24
25PYTHON_VERSIONS_INCOMPATIBLE= 27 25PYTHON_VERSIONS_INCOMPATIBLE= 27
26 26
27post-install: 
28 cd ${DESTDIR}${PREFIX}/bin && \ 
29 ${MV} cli-name cli-name-${PYVERSSUFFIX} || ${TRUE} 
30 
31TEST_ENV+= PYTHONPATH=${WRKSRC}/build/lib 27TEST_ENV+= PYTHONPATH=${WRKSRC}/build/lib
32 28
33do-test: 29do-test:
34 ${LN} -f ${WRKSRC}/examples.py ${WRKSRC}/tests/examples.py 30 ${LN} -f ${WRKSRC}/examples.py ${WRKSRC}/tests/examples.py
35 cd ${WRKSRC} && ${SETENV} ${TEST_ENV} pytest-${PYVERSSUFFIX} tests 31 cd ${WRKSRC} && ${SETENV} ${TEST_ENV} pytest-${PYVERSSUFFIX} tests
36 32
37.include "../../lang/python/wheel.mk" 33.include "../../lang/python/wheel.mk"
38.include "../../mk/bsd.pkg.mk" 34.include "../../mk/bsd.pkg.mk"

cvs diff -r1.3 -r1.4 pkgsrc/devel/py-progressbar2/PLIST (expand / switch to unified diff)

--- pkgsrc/devel/py-progressbar2/PLIST 2023/12/18 05:48:47 1.3
+++ pkgsrc/devel/py-progressbar2/PLIST 2024/01/04 22:42:52 1.4
@@ -1,30 +1,19 @@ @@ -1,30 +1,19 @@
1@comment $NetBSD: PLIST,v 1.3 2023/12/18 05:48:47 adam Exp $ 1@comment $NetBSD: PLIST,v 1.4 2024/01/04 22:42:52 adam Exp $
2bin/cli-name-${PYVERSSUFFIX} 
3${PYSITELIB}/${WHEEL_INFODIR}/LICENSE 2${PYSITELIB}/${WHEEL_INFODIR}/LICENSE
4${PYSITELIB}/${WHEEL_INFODIR}/METADATA 3${PYSITELIB}/${WHEEL_INFODIR}/METADATA
5${PYSITELIB}/${WHEEL_INFODIR}/RECORD 4${PYSITELIB}/${WHEEL_INFODIR}/RECORD
6${PYSITELIB}/${WHEEL_INFODIR}/WHEEL 5${PYSITELIB}/${WHEEL_INFODIR}/WHEEL
7${PYSITELIB}/${WHEEL_INFODIR}/entry_points.txt 
8${PYSITELIB}/${WHEEL_INFODIR}/top_level.txt 6${PYSITELIB}/${WHEEL_INFODIR}/top_level.txt
9${PYSITELIB}/docs/_theme/LICENSE 
10${PYSITELIB}/docs/_theme/flask_theme_support.py 
11${PYSITELIB}/docs/_theme/flask_theme_support.pyc 
12${PYSITELIB}/docs/_theme/flask_theme_support.pyo 
13${PYSITELIB}/docs/_theme/wolph/layout.html 
14${PYSITELIB}/docs/_theme/wolph/relations.html 
15${PYSITELIB}/docs/_theme/wolph/static/flasky.css_t 
16${PYSITELIB}/docs/_theme/wolph/static/small_flask.css 
17${PYSITELIB}/docs/_theme/wolph/theme.conf 
18${PYSITELIB}/progressbar/__about__.py 7${PYSITELIB}/progressbar/__about__.py
19${PYSITELIB}/progressbar/__about__.pyc 8${PYSITELIB}/progressbar/__about__.pyc
20${PYSITELIB}/progressbar/__about__.pyo 9${PYSITELIB}/progressbar/__about__.pyo
21${PYSITELIB}/progressbar/__init__.py 10${PYSITELIB}/progressbar/__init__.py
22${PYSITELIB}/progressbar/__init__.pyc 11${PYSITELIB}/progressbar/__init__.pyc
23${PYSITELIB}/progressbar/__init__.pyo 12${PYSITELIB}/progressbar/__init__.pyo
24${PYSITELIB}/progressbar/bar.py 13${PYSITELIB}/progressbar/bar.py
25${PYSITELIB}/progressbar/bar.pyc 14${PYSITELIB}/progressbar/bar.pyc
26${PYSITELIB}/progressbar/bar.pyo 15${PYSITELIB}/progressbar/bar.pyo
27${PYSITELIB}/progressbar/base.py 16${PYSITELIB}/progressbar/base.py
28${PYSITELIB}/progressbar/base.pyc 17${PYSITELIB}/progressbar/base.pyc
29${PYSITELIB}/progressbar/base.pyo 18${PYSITELIB}/progressbar/base.pyo
30${PYSITELIB}/progressbar/env.py 19${PYSITELIB}/progressbar/env.py

cvs diff -r1.8 -r1.9 pkgsrc/devel/py-progressbar2/distinfo (expand / switch to unified diff)

--- pkgsrc/devel/py-progressbar2/distinfo 2023/12/18 05:48:47 1.8
+++ pkgsrc/devel/py-progressbar2/distinfo 2024/01/04 22:42:52 1.9
@@ -1,5 +1,5 @@ @@ -1,5 +1,5 @@
1$NetBSD: distinfo,v 1.8 2023/12/18 05:48:47 adam Exp $ 1$NetBSD: distinfo,v 1.9 2024/01/04 22:42:52 adam Exp $
2 2
3BLAKE2s (progressbar2-4.3.0.tar.gz) = 31911a4fd16cc84ef7fb39f656f80803302d7e3faeef01d01e5c49b7984e30d9 3BLAKE2s (progressbar2-4.3.2.tar.gz) = 77f7f858dcd9066bc42f666413bcbd918e274f07c0d0b4739b9a15e88e655858
4SHA512 (progressbar2-4.3.0.tar.gz) = 7cb5a2e474131ca96d7ab997ebb53defa63cb208faf0e6ed6da670386c6ef5da088c90efbc373f4dd9528196b7f7a29b529db52bdd9cf03e2175225e3f13b08a 4SHA512 (progressbar2-4.3.2.tar.gz) = d885a8b568149acf7a2cb5e5698f8677ee777c11a907f187c70c4ff4b52c656c40439ac8af00b652e5ddd4325721863c66b9f1a1b9a95d84f5fe081f94e4e0bf
5Size (progressbar2-4.3.0.tar.gz) = 91964 bytes 5Size (progressbar2-4.3.2.tar.gz) = 92504 bytes